WebApr 29, 2024 · Hydro Power Plant. The Hydro Power Plant is a dam with turbines. At the maximum output of 1.600 MW, the Hydro Power Plant costs $2/MW upkeep, which theoretically makes it extremely efficient. However, such values are difficult to achieve, as it is not easy in Cities Skylines to find such a good spot for a dam that can produce such … WebThe hydro power plant is a power-generating structure capable of generating between zero to 1,600 megawatts. The hydro power plant must be built over a river with each end point connecting to some form of land. …

The amount of power that the dam can distribute depends on the potential energy above and below the dam—the greater this difference, the more power output. ... Hydro power plant: Electricity ₡2000/cell … how do the lines work in slingoWebHydro power plants depend on height difference between the two sides of the dam, so there needs to be a significant elevation change in the river just upstream of the dam placement. It also won't work if you build the dam too tall in relation to the water level.
